00:25August 3rd. Let's look at what's happening in Korea's property market. Two months ago,
00:32before the capital gains tax overhaul took effect, Seoul apartment sales went crazy. In May,
00:3927.9% of all transactions were above 1.5 billion won. That's not normal. That's panic. By June,
00:47after the tax law passed, that share dropped to 23.5%. By July, right now, only 18% of sales
00:56are in
00:57that tier. The high-end market moved forward. It didn't vanish, but it moved.
01:03The second shift hit at the same time. The financial regulator just announced new loan policy. Here's
01:10what passed. New apartments only. Interest-free down payment loans for new construction. But,
01:17and this matters, not for used apartments. Not even a 5% boost to LTV for first-time buyers or
01:24newlyweds. The reasoning is clean. Housing supply is still short. Lower borrowing thresholds would
01:31drive up prices, not sales. The government chose price stability over demand support.
01:38These two moves squeeze the middle market hardest. Used apartments in mid-priced areas are where most
01:4530-something professionals buy their first place. New construction loans just became easier.
01:51Used apartment financing just got tighter. If you're shopping now, you have two choices.
01:56Bid on new construction where financing works. Or, accelerate your used apartment purchase before
